The active ingredients here include a range of natural oils, as well as glycerin and others to give your skin back it’s natural firm and elastic quality. The ingredients list on the Vichy cream are a little bit of a shock. Whilst it is completely normal to see ingredient lists like this on cosmetic products, the trend now is very much geared towards all natural. The Vichy includes several chemical agents, and neglects to use plant alternatives. It also includes parabens which have become controversial lately over connections to cancer.

Price

The Vichy range is really popular, and can be picked up from various suppliers meaning the price can really vary. Pharmacies usually price the 200 ml bottle of Vichy Complete Action Stretch Mark Cream at around $50, Amazon is a little less dear at $38, but if you shop around you can find it for as little as $20 with added delivery.
